    • #3
      Most "no fail" tradeskill combines have a trivial of 15. There may be some with a trivial of 0, but there are no recipes with a trivial of 1-14 and every recipe that is trivial at 15 never fails. This is why I like to give every new character a few stacks of silk to turn into swatches or threads. I may never work that character's skills any higher, but the silks needed to be combined by someone and I might as well get a start on tailoring while I am doing so.
